Table Salt to Melt Ice | Sciencing Both rock salt and table salt lower the freezing point of water, but rock salt granules are larger and may contain impurities, so they don't do it as well. It's a bit inaccurate to say that salt melts ice, although that is definitely how things appear at temperatures near the normal freezing point.

Why Does Salt Melt Ice? | Britannica So, if you're using table salt, also known as sodium chloride (NaCl), to melt ice, the salt will dissolve into separate sodium ions and chloride ions. Calcium chloride is more effective at melting ice because it can break down into three ions instead of two: one calcium ion and two chloride ions.
